Walking on dirt isn't "earthing" you electrically any more than a severed power line in a rainstorm. There is an exchange of potential, but nothing you would feel.

Different patches of dirt are at different electrical potentials anyway. It's not meaningfully different from walking on your floor.

>There's difference in charge between those two points, neglible but there is...
None that doesn't exist between any other grounding method.
Your sink is connected to your plumbing which is connected to a series of buried conductive tubes.
Metal chassis are usually connected to the ground pin on the power plug, which is either tied to your plumbing or to an independent wire that's driven into the dirt.
The screws on your light switch are tied to the light switch's housing which is tied to wherever your ground pin goes.

Any variance in electrical potential between these points would be replicated in the metal fill under your floor.
By the way, grounded floors are already a thing. They're commonplace wherever you find people working with sensitive electrical equipment.
